Scraping grex with Prometheus¶
Recommended layout¶
Two scrape jobs against the same telemetry host:port, different paths.
scrape_configs:
- job_name: grex-server
metrics_path: /metrics
scrape_interval: 15s
static_configs:
- targets: ["grex:9090"]
- job_name: grex-fleet
metrics_path: /metrics/fleet
scrape_interval: 30s # ≈ heartbeat granularity
sample_limit: 5000 # protect Prometheus; tune to fleet size
static_configs:
- targets: ["grex:9090"]
This matches deploy/compose/prometheus.yaml used in local development.
When the telemetry listener requires mTLS¶
If telemetry_tls.client_ca_file is set, add scheme: https and a
tls_config with a client certificate mapped to a role in
auth.role_mapping (see Authentication):
scrape_configs:
- job_name: grex-server
scheme: https
metrics_path: /metrics
tls_config:
ca_file: /certs/ca.pem
cert_file: /certs/service-prometheus.pem
key_file: /certs/service-prometheus-key.pem
static_configs:
- targets: ["grex:9090"]
/healthz and /readyz stay reachable without a client certificate even
when telemetry_tls.client_ca_file is set; only /metrics,
/metrics/fleet, and /debug/pprof/* require one.
Choosing intervals¶
| Job | Guidance |
|---|---|
grex-server |
Short interval (10–30s) for API latency and process health |
grex-fleet |
Near fleet.heartbeat_interval (default 30s); faster scrapes mostly re-read the same registry snapshot |
sample_limit¶
Prometheus sample_limit is per scrape job. Put a limit on
grex-fleet so a misconfigured cardinality explosion cannot drop
grex-server samples you need for diagnosis.
Also set metrics.per_agent_series_limit in grex so the process itself stops
emitting per-uid series above the cap (see Cardinality).
Network access¶
Application authentication is optional (see above); when
telemetry_tls.client_ca_file is unset, the telemetry listener has no
application authentication. Restrict it with:
- Bind address (e.g. internal interface only)
- Network policies / security groups
- Mesh or reverse proxy IP allowlists
Do not expose :9090 to the public internet, especially if
debug.pprof_enabled is true.
Service discovery¶
Helm ServiceMonitors (optional)¶
The Helm chart can create two Prometheus Operator
ServiceMonitor resources when serviceMonitor.enabled=true: one for
/metrics and one for /metrics/fleet, with independent intervals. That
matches the dual-job layout above and the compose Prometheus config.
Requires the Prometheus Operator CRDs in the cluster. Set
serviceMonitor.labels so your Prometheus instance selects the monitors.
Without the operator¶
Point static configs, file SD, annotation-based discovery, or your
platform’s SD at the telemetry port. Keep the two jobs even if targets are
identical. The chart’s metrics.serviceAnnotations.enabled only annotates
the Service for /metrics; it does not create a second fleet job—use an
external scrape config or ServiceMonitors for that.
Relabeling¶
Useful labels to attach externally (not emitted by grex):
env,cluster,regionfor multi-fleet deployments (one grex per fleet)instancealready comes from Prometheus target labels
Avoid relabeling away instance_uid on fleet series if you rely on per-agent
dashboards—and prefer aggregates when fleets are large.
